The new Jawa 350 is priced at Rs. 2.14 lakh, ex-showroom, Delhi. It is available in one variant and three colours.
The Jawa 350 is powered by a 334cc, single-cylinder, liquid-cooled engine that makes 22.5bhp at 7,000rpm and 28.1Nm at 5,000rpm and is paired with a six-speed gearbox. This engine is the same unit as the one you see in the Jawa Perak, but it is in a lower state of tune and makes less power. Jawa says that the engine is tuned to offer strong low and mid-range performance, which should make it more tractable than the Perak. That in turn will make it a pretty relaxed commuter in the city as well.
The Jawa 350 employs a double cradle frame that is suspended by a 35mm, telescopic fork and twin shock absorbers with preload adjustability. It has a longer wheelbase than that of the Jawa Standard at 1,449mm. That should give it better straight-line stability as well as a planted feel in the corners. The bike also gets a wider, 130-section, tube-type rear and 100-section front tyre, both of which are mounted on wire-spoke wheels.
Braking duties are carried out by a 280mm disc at the front and a 240mm disc at the rear and dual-channel ABS comes as standard. The Jawa 350 weighs 194kg and offers a class-leading 178mm of ground clearance.
As for the design, it looks neat, with swooping fenders, tear-drop-shaped tank, and a chunky side panel. There are three colours on offer- maroon, black, and Mystique Orange. The latter is the new colour option.
The Jawa 350 will go up against the Royal Enfield Classic 350 and the Honda CB350. Both of these motorcycles have single-cylinder, air-cooled engines and make less power than the Jawa 350’s engine.
